NYSE:MSB
Mesabi Trust
- Stock
Last Close
34.25
06/11 21:10
Market Cap
226.71M
Beta: 0.97
Volume Today
31.06K
Avg: 47.41K
PE Ratio
22.89
PFCF: 30.70
Dividend Yield
3.66%
Payout:0%
Preview
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page
Jan '15 | Apr '15 | Jul '15 | Oct '15 | Jan '16 | Apr '16 | Jul '16 | Oct '16 | Jan '17 | Apr '17 | Jul '17 | Oct '17 | Jan '18 | Apr '18 | Jul '18 | Oct '18 | Jan '19 | Apr '19 | Jul '19 | Oct '19 | Jan '20 | Apr '20 | Jul '20 | Oct '20 | Jan '21 | Apr '21 | Jul '21 | Oct '21 | Jan '22 | Apr '22 | Jul '22 | Oct '22 | Jan '23 | Apr '23 | Jul '23 | Oct '23 | Jan '24 | Apr '24 | Jul '24 | Oct '24 | Jan '25 | ||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
revenue | 5.93M - | 1.32M 77.81% | 2.73M 107.67% | 2.62M 4.16% | 3.05M 16.32% | 1.68K 99.94% | 2.61M 155,267.42% | 3.44M 31.93% | 4.68M 36.02% | 3.65M 22.03% | 13.35M 265.66% | 12.17M 8.86% | 5.31M 56.33% | 6.65M 25.12% | 19.13M 187.74% | 13.89M 27.37% | 7.37M 46.94% | 5.36M 27.26% | 14.30M 166.74% | 6.49M 54.63% | 5.56M 14.37% | 2.14M 61.56% | 7.22M 238.02% | 5.74M 20.53% | 10.83M 88.72% | 9.40M 13.14% | 27.74M 195.08% | 15.84M 42.92% | 17.95M 13.37% | 14.20M 20.93% | 84.68K 99.40% | 84.68K 0% | -2.30M 2,813.86% | 1.85M 180.45% | 9.89M 434.89% | 4.66M 52.84% | 6.23M 33.53% | 6.25M 0.36% | 6.49M 3.83% | 79.00M 1,117.30% | 5.84M 92.61% | |
cost of revenue | -522.03K - | 1.54M - | 2.77M 80.00% | 786.29K - | ||||||||||||||||||||||||||||||||||||||
gross profit | 5.93M - | 1.32M 77.81% | 2.73M 107.67% | 2.62M 4.16% | 3.05M 16.32% | 1.68K 99.94% | 2.61M 155,267.42% | 3.44M 31.93% | 4.68M 36.02% | 3.65M 22.03% | 13.35M 265.66% | 12.17M 8.86% | 5.31M 56.33% | 6.65M 25.12% | 19.13M 187.74% | 13.89M 27.37% | 7.37M 46.94% | 5.36M 27.26% | 14.30M 166.74% | 6.49M 54.63% | 5.56M 14.37% | 2.14M 61.56% | 7.22M 238.02% | 5.74M 20.53% | 10.83M 88.72% | 9.40M 13.14% | 27.74M 195.08% | 16.36M 41.04% | 17.95M 9.76% | 14.20M 20.93% | 84.68K 99.40% | 84.68K 0% | -2.30M 2,813.86% | 1.85M 180.45% | 9.89M 434.89% | 4.66M 52.84% | 4.69M 0.57% | 3.48M 25.73% | 6.49M 86.29% | 79.00M 1,117.30% | 5.06M 93.60% | |
selling and marketing expenses | ||||||||||||||||||||||||||||||||||||||||||
general and administrative expenses | -264.41K - | 377.74K 242.86% | 251.72K 33.36% | 219.50K 12.80% | 2.62K 98.81% | 431.93K 16,367.06% | 189.39K 56.15% | 234.49K 23.82% | -95.15K 140.58% | 295.05K 410.08% | 240.49K 18.49% | 227.33K 5.47% | -17.46K 107.68% | 368.20K 2,209.06% | 280.50K 23.82% | 388.78K 38.60% | -45.12K 111.61% | 556.59K 1,333.48% | 432.54K 22.29% | 410.64K 5.06% | -58.31K 114.20% | 557.14K 1,055.42% | 542.38K 2.65% | |||||||||||||||||||
selling general and administrative expenses | -264.41K - | 377.74K 242.86% | 251.72K 33.36% | 219.50K 12.80% | 2.62K 98.81% | 431.93K 16,367.06% | 189.39K 56.15% | 234.49K 23.82% | -95.15K 140.58% | 295.05K 410.08% | 240.49K 18.49% | 227.33K 5.47% | -17.46K 107.68% | 368.20K 2,209.06% | 280.50K 23.82% | 388.78K 38.60% | -45.12K 111.61% | 556.59K 1,333.48% | 432.54K 22.29% | 410.64K 5.06% | -58.31K 114.20% | 557.14K 1,055.42% | 542.38K 2.65% | 825.71K - | 705.90K 14.51% | 2.77M - | 1.09M 60.53% | 12.98K - | ||||||||||||||
research and development expenses | ||||||||||||||||||||||||||||||||||||||||||
other expenses | 804.94K - | -377.74K 146.93% | -251.72K 33.36% | -219.50K 12.80% | 780.10K 455.40% | -431.93K 155.37% | -189.39K 56.15% | -234.49K 23.82% | 740.48K 415.78% | -295.05K 139.85% | -240.49K 18.49% | -227.33K 5.47% | 711.14K 412.82% | -368.20K 151.78% | -280.50K 23.82% | -388.78K 38.60% | 631.89K 262.53% | -556.59K 188.08% | -432.54K 22.29% | -410.64K 5.06% | 1.15M 380.57% | -557.14K 148.36% | -542.38K 2.65% | -610.86K 12.62% | 1.37M 323.88% | -828.78K 160.60% | -988.18K 19.23% | -365.30K 63.03% | 2.13M 682.76% | -601.06K 128.23% | -490.56K 18.38% | -498.37K 1.59% | 1.54M 408.55% | -825.71K 153.70% | -705.90K 14.51% | -810K 14.75% | 2.01M 348.32% | -2.77M 237.56% | 7.35M - | |||
cost and expenses | -41.02K - | 377.74K 1,020.83% | 251.72K 33.36% | 219.50K 12.80% | 190.91K 13.03% | 431.93K 126.25% | 189.39K 56.15% | 234.49K 23.82% | 93.64K 60.07% | 295.05K 215.10% | 240.49K 18.49% | 227.33K 5.47% | 190.06K 16.39% | 368.20K 93.73% | 280.50K 23.82% | 388.78K 38.60% | 219.16K 43.63% | 556.59K 153.97% | 432.54K 22.29% | 410.64K 5.06% | 213.13K 48.10% | 557.14K 161.40% | 542.38K 2.65% | -610.86K 212.62% | 1.37M 323.88% | -828.78K 160.60% | -988.18K 19.23% | -887.33K 10.21% | 2.13M 339.92% | -601.06K 128.23% | -490.56K 18.38% | -498.37K 1.59% | 1.54M 408.55% | 825.71K 46.30% | 705.90K 14.51% | -810K 214.75% | 1.54M 289.76% | 2.77M 80.00% | 1.09M 60.53% | 7.35M 572.92% | 799.27K 89.12% | |
operating expenses | -264.41K - | 377.74K 242.86% | 251.72K 33.36% | 219.50K 12.80% | 2.62K 98.81% | 431.93K 16,367.06% | 189.39K 56.15% | 234.49K 23.82% | -95.15K 140.58% | 295.05K 410.08% | 240.49K 18.49% | 227.33K 5.47% | -17.46K 107.68% | 368.20K 2,209.06% | 280.50K 23.82% | 388.78K 38.60% | -45.12K 111.61% | 556.59K 1,333.48% | 432.54K 22.29% | 410.64K 5.06% | -58.31K 114.20% | 557.14K 1,055.42% | 542.38K 2.65% | -610.86K 212.62% | 1.37M 323.88% | -828.78K 160.60% | -988.18K 19.23% | -365.30K 63.03% | 2.13M 682.76% | -601.06K 128.23% | -490.56K 18.38% | -498.37K 1.59% | 1.54M 408.55% | 825.71K 46.30% | 705.90K 14.51% | -810K 214.75% | -1 100.00% | -2.77M 276,678,600% | 1.09M 139.47% | 7.35M 572.92% | 12.98K 99.82% | |
interest expense | -156.73K - | -70.58K 54.97% | 759 101.08% | 34.24K 4,410.94% | 84.68K 147.33% | -119.68K 241.33% | ||||||||||||||||||||||||||||||||||||
ebitda | 4.91M - | 1.32M 73.20% | 2.73M 107.67% | 2.62M 4.16% | 2.00M 23.70% | -430.25K 121.53% | 2.61M 706.30% | 3.44M 31.93% | 3.73M 8.27% | 3.65M 2.04% | 13.35M 265.66% | 12.17M 8.86% | 4.35M 64.23% | 6.65M 52.73% | 19.13M 187.74% | 13.89M 27.37% | 6.11M 56.04% | 5.36M 12.20% | 14.30M 166.74% | 6.49M 54.63% | 3.94M 39.33% | 2.14M 45.75% | 7.22M 238.02% | 5.74M 20.53% | 8.70M 51.60% | 9.40M 8.12% | 27.74M 195.08% | 15.84M 42.92% | 15.38M 2.85% | 14.20M 7.73% | -4.40M 131.00% | -329.01K 92.52% | -4.68M 1,322.06% | 1.71M 136.58% | 9.73M 468.60% | 4.66M 52.07% | 4.69M 0.57% | 7.35M - | 1.02M 86.06% | |||
operating income | 4.91M - | 1.32M 73.20% | 2.73M 107.67% | 2.62M 4.16% | 2.00M 23.70% | -430.25K 121.53% | 2.61M 706.30% | 3.44M 31.93% | 3.73M 8.27% | 3.65M 2.04% | 13.35M 265.66% | 12.17M 8.86% | 4.35M 64.23% | 6.65M 52.73% | 19.13M 187.74% | 13.89M 27.37% | 6.11M 56.04% | 5.36M 12.20% | 14.30M 166.74% | 6.49M 54.63% | 3.94M 39.33% | 2.14M 45.75% | 7.22M 238.02% | 5.74M 20.53% | 8.70M 51.60% | 9.40M 8.12% | 27.74M 195.08% | 15.84M 42.92% | 15.38M 2.85% | 14.80M 3.83% | -3.98M 126.89% | -329.01K 91.73% | -5.70M 1,632.57% | 1.02M 117.95% | 9.18M 797.57% | 4.09M 55.51% | 4.69M 14.80% | 3.48M 25.73% | 5.40M 54.94% | 71.65M 1,227.43% | 5.04M 92.96% | |
depreciation and amortization | 156.73K - | 1.99M 1,168.25% | -599.54K 130.16% | -422.08K 29.60% | 1.02M - | -1.02M 200.15% | -9.18M 797.57% | 578.03K 106.29% | -3.48M - | -5.40M 54.94% | -5.04M - | |||||||||||||||||||||||||||||||
total other income expenses net | 804.94K - | -377.74K 146.93% | -251.72K 33.36% | -219.50K 12.80% | 780.10K 455.40% | -431.93K 155.37% | -189.39K 56.15% | -234.49K 23.82% | 740.48K 415.78% | -295.05K 139.85% | -240.49K 18.49% | -227.33K 5.47% | 711.14K 412.82% | -368.20K 151.78% | -280.50K 23.82% | -388.78K 38.60% | 631.89K 262.53% | -556.59K 188.08% | -432.54K 22.29% | -410.64K 5.06% | 1.15M 380.57% | -557.14K 148.36% | -542.38K 2.65% | -610.86K 12.62% | 1.37M 323.88% | -828.78K 160.60% | -988.18K 19.23% | -365.30K 63.03% | 2.13M 682.76% | -1.20M 156.36% | -878.41K 26.79% | -84.68K 90.36% | 2.69M 3,271.10% | -825.71K 130.75% | -705.90K 14.51% | -810K 14.75% | 1 100.00% | -2.53M 252,682,400% | 6.67M - | 1.02M 84.64% | ||
income before tax | 5.67M - | 940.27K 83.43% | 2.48M 164.14% | 2.40M 3.28% | 2.73M 13.77% | -430.25K 115.74% | 2.42M 662.52% | 3.21M 32.55% | 4.41M 37.62% | 3.36M 23.86% | 13.11M 290.10% | 11.96M 8.77% | 5.06M 57.75% | 6.32M 24.93% | 18.87M 198.80% | 13.59M 28.01% | 6.79M 50.04% | 4.91M 27.65% | 13.91M 183.32% | 6.15M 55.79% | 5.08M 17.34% | 1.61M 68.30% | 6.68M 314.24% | 5.13M 23.21% | 9.99M 94.94% | 8.57M 14.21% | 26.76M 212.06% | 15.99M 40.23% | 17.44M 9.07% | 13.60M 22.06% | -4.86M 135.73% | -413.69K 91.48% | -3.02M 628.81% | 1.02M 133.93% | 9.18M 797.57% | 4.09M 55.51% | 4.69M 14.80% | 3.48M 25.73% | 5.40M 54.94% | 78.33M 1,351.04% | 6.07M 92.25% | |
income tax expense | -156.73K - | -1.99M 1,168.25% | 599.54K 130.16% | 422.08K 29.60% | -1.66M - | 885.61K 153.23% | 9.02M 919.04% | -810K 108.98% | 3.48M - | |||||||||||||||||||||||||||||||||
net income | 5.67M - | 940.27K 83.43% | 2.48M 164.14% | 2.40M 3.28% | 2.73M 13.77% | -430.25K 115.74% | 2.42M 662.52% | 3.21M 32.55% | 4.41M 37.62% | 3.36M 23.86% | 13.11M 290.10% | 11.96M 8.77% | 5.06M 57.75% | 6.32M 24.93% | 18.87M 198.80% | 13.59M 28.01% | 6.79M 50.04% | 4.91M 27.65% | 13.91M 183.32% | 6.15M 55.79% | 5.08M 17.34% | 1.61M 68.30% | 6.68M 314.24% | 5.13M 23.21% | 9.99M 94.94% | 8.57M 14.21% | 26.76M 212.06% | 15.99M 40.23% | 17.44M 9.07% | 13.60M 22.06% | -5.28M 138.83% | -413.69K 92.16% | -1.35M 226.66% | 1.02M 175.71% | 9.18M 797.57% | 4.09M 55.51% | 4.69M 14.80% | 3.48M 25.73% | 5.40M 54.94% | 78.33M 1,351.04% | 6.07M 92.25% | |
weighted average shs out | 13.12M - |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0.00% | 13.12M 0.00% | 13.12M 0.00%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| |
weighted average shs out dil | 13.12M - |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| 13.12M 0% | |
eps | 0.43 - | 0.07 83.33% | 0.19 164.99% | 0.18 5.26% | 0.21 16.67% | -0.03 115.62% | 0.18 648.78% | 0.24 33.33% | 0.34 41.67% | 0.34 0% | 1.07 214.71% | 0.82 23.36% | 0.39 52.44% | 0.48 23.08% | 1.44 200% | 1.04 27.78% | 0.52 50% | 0.37 28.85% | 1.06 186.49% | 0.47 55.66% | 0.39 17.02% | 0.12 69.23% | 0.51 325.00% | 0.39 23.53% | 0.76 94.87% | 0.65 14.47% | 2.04 213.85% | 1.22 40.20% | 1.48 21.31% | 1.04 29.73% | -0.40 138.46% | -0.03 92.13% | -0.10 217.46% | 0.08 178.00% | 0.70 797.44% | 0.31 55.71% | 0.36 16.13% | 0.27 25.00% | 0.41 51.85% | 5.97 1,356.10% | 0.46 92.29% | |
epsdiluted | 0.43 - | 0.07 83.33% | 0.19 164.99% | 0.18 5.26% | 0.21 16.67% | -0.03 115.62% | 0.18 648.78% | 0.24 33.33% | 0.34 41.67% | 0.34 0% | 1.07 214.71% | 0.82 23.36% | 0.39 52.44% | 0.48 23.08% | 1.44 200% | 1.04 27.78% | 0.52 50% | 0.37 28.85% | 1.06 186.49% | 0.47 55.66% | 0.39 17.02% | 0.12 69.23% | 0.51 325.00% | 0.39 23.53% | 0.76 94.87% | 0.65 14.47% | 2.04 213.85% | 1.22 40.20% | 1.48 21.31% | 1.04 29.73% | -0.40 138.46% | -0.03 92.13% | -0.10 217.46% | 0.08 178.00% | 0.70 797.44% | 0.31 55.71% | 0.36 16.13% | 0.27 25.00% | 0.41 51.85% | 5.97 1,356.10% | 0.46 92.29% |
All numbers in USD (except ratios and percentages)